The Physiological Timeline of a 24-Hour Fast

Your body's response to not eating is a predictable, multi-stage process governed by your energy needs. The timeline is generally broken down into key phases:

  • The Fed State (0–6 hours): Immediately after eating, your body is in the fed state, digesting and absorbing nutrients. During this time, blood sugar and insulin levels are elevated. Your body uses the glucose from your last meal as its primary energy source and stores any excess as glycogen in the liver and muscles.
  • The Early Fasting State (6–18 hours): As your body uses up its immediate glucose supply, insulin levels drop. It begins to tap into the stored glycogen to maintain blood sugar levels. This is the phase where most people start to feel real hunger pangs as the body begins its transition.
  • The Fasting State (18–24 hours): Around the 18 to 24-hour mark, your liver's glycogen reserves are depleted. At this point, a crucial metabolic switch occurs. The body shifts from primarily using glucose for fuel to breaking down stored fat for energy, a process called lipolysis. This produces molecules called ketones, which many cells, including the brain, can use for fuel.

The Key Mechanisms Behind the Fasting 'Reset'

The Metabolic Switch and Ketosis

The shift from glucose to fat as a primary fuel source is perhaps the most significant effect of a 24-hour fast. This metabolic switch promotes greater metabolic flexibility—the body's ability to efficiently switch between different fuel sources depending on availability. This process leads to mild ketosis, where the body's energy is supplied by ketones derived from fat breakdown. Ketones are considered a more efficient and cleaner source of fuel for the brain and body.

Autophagy: Cellular Recycling

Fasting is a powerful stimulus for autophagy, a natural cellular “housekeeping” process. During autophagy, the body breaks down and recycles damaged or dysfunctional cells, proteins, and organelles. This process is like hitting a deep-clean button, removing cellular junk and promoting the regeneration of new, healthier cells. Autophagy has been linked to potential benefits like reduced inflammation, improved immune function, and a lower risk of chronic diseases.

Hormonal Rebalancing

A short-term fast also leads to beneficial hormonal changes. Insulin levels decrease significantly, improving insulin sensitivity over time. Simultaneously, the production of human growth hormone (HGH) increases, which helps preserve lean muscle mass and assists with tissue repair. Furthermore, fasting can help rebalance hunger hormones like ghrelin (the hunger hormone) and leptin (the satiety hormone), which can help regulate appetite.

Risks and Considerations of Not Eating for a Day

While a 24-hour fast can be beneficial for many, it is not without risks and is not suitable for everyone. Potential side effects can include:

  • Headaches and Fatigue: Especially for first-timers, headaches, fatigue, and irritability are common as the body adjusts to using ketones for fuel. Proper hydration is key to mitigating these symptoms.
  • Hypoglycemia: Individuals with diabetes, especially those on medication, should not fast without medical supervision, as it can cause dangerously low blood sugar levels.
  • Eating Disorder Risk: For individuals with a history of eating disorders, fasting can trigger harmful behaviors and should be avoided.
  • Other Contraindications: Fasting is also not recommended for pregnant or breastfeeding women, children, adolescents, or individuals with certain chronic diseases.
